Price for Tobacco, Unmanufactured; Tobacco Refuse in Spain (FOB) - 2022
In 2022, the average tobacco, unmanufactured; tobacco refuse export price amounted to $3,956 per ton, increasing by 1.5% against the previous year. In general, the export price, however, saw a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2014 an increase of 13%. As a result, the export price attained the peak level of $4,893 per ton. From 2015 to 2022, the average export prices remained at a somewhat l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Portugal ($5,170 per ton), while the average price for exports to Cote d'Ivoire ($702 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Italy (+3.9%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Price for Tobacco, Unmanufactured; Tobacco Refuse in Spain (CIF) - 2022
The average tobacco, unmanufactured; tobacco refuse import price stood at $24,921 per ton in 2022, surging by 6.8%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price continues to indicate a buoyant increase.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2017 an increase of 65% against the previous year. Over the period under review, average import prices attained the peak figure in 2022 and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Indonesia ($118,378 per ton), while the price for France ($3,922 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by the Dominican Republic (+16.5%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Exports of Tobacco, Unmanufactured; Tobacco Refuse in Spain
In 2022, the amount of tobacco, unmanufactured; tobacco refuses exported from Spain reached 22K tons, rising by 1.8% on the year before. In general, exports, however, continue to indicate a pronounced contraction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 4.4%.
In value terms, tobacco, unmanufactured; tobacco refuse exports rose to $86M in 2022. Over the period under review, exports, however, continue to indicate a slight descent.

Imports of Tobacco, Unmanufactured; Tobacco Refuse in Spain
For the third year in a row, Spain recorded decline in supplies from abroad of tobacco, unmanufactured; tobacco refuses, which decreased by -1.6% to 2.3K tons in 2022. In general, imports faced a abrupt contraction.
In value terms, tobacco, unmanufactured; tobacco refuse imports rose markedly to $56M in 2022. The total import value increased at an average annual rate of +5.4% over the period from 2019 to 2022; however, the trend pattern remained consistent, with only minor f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 5.9%. Imports peaked in 2022 and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
